    Top Apps for Black Photo Editing – Enhance Your Dark Tones Easily

    AnishBy AnishOctober 20, 2025
    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n
    Top Apps for Black Photo Editing – Enhance Your Dark Tones Easily

    Editing apps specializing in black, black-and-white, or dark themes have surged in popularity. These tools allow users to craft dramatic, moody, vintage, or minimalist visuals by reducing or removing color, enhancing contrast, manipulating shadows and light, or applying dark backgrounds and filters. Beyond photography, these apps are invaluable for video editing, social media content, branding, advertising, and album art, offering creative flexibility for a variety of visual projects.

    What is a “Black Editing App”

    When we talk about a “black editing app,” we refer to tools designed to help you:

    • Transform color images or videos into black & white or monochrome.
    • Apply dark or black backgrounds—including solid black, textured patterns, or dark gradients—to photos or portraits.
    • Enhance contrast, shadows, and highlights in darker areas for a more striking visual impact.
    • Use filters, textures, grain, borders, duotone, or film-style effects to achieve a moody, cinematic aesthetic.
    • Blend color selectively with black & white (the “color splash” effect) to highlight specific parts of an image while keeping the rest monochrome.

    These apps can be standalone, mobile, or desktop-based, and may cater to photography, video editing, social media content, branding, and more.

    Why Use Black / Monochrome / Dark Themes

    People choose black, monochrome, or dark-style editing for many creative and practical reasons:

    Mood & Emotion

    Black & white or dark tones evoke dramatic, emotional, and nostalgic moods. Removing color shifts attention to texture, shape, form, and expression, making visuals feel more powerful.

    Focus on Subject & Details

    Without color distractions, viewers notice contrast, shadows, lines, facial features, and textures. This makes it ideal for portraits, architecture, and artistic photography.

    Timeless & Classic Look

    Monochrome designs carry a vintage, timeless appeal. Film-style black & white aesthetics are still highly valued for creating a classic, artistic impression.

    Consistency & Branding

    For social media, portfolios, or brand identity, maintaining a consistent dark or monochrome theme unifies your visual style and strengthens recognition.

    Highlighting Light & Shadow

    Dramatic lighting stands out more in black and dark edits. Shadows become integral, and highlights pop, enhancing the overall moody aesthetic.

    Minimalism

    Eliminating extra colors simplifies images, declutters visuals, and creates a clean, minimalist style that emphasizes the subject.

    Key Features in a Good Black Editing App

    When selecting an app for black, dark, or monochrome editing, look for these key features:

    FeatureWhy It Matters
    Black & White / Monochrome FiltersBasic conversion, but quality of rendering (tones, contrast) vary greatly.
    Contrast, Exposure, Highlights / Shadows ControlsTo fine-tune how dark or light different part of image is. Crucial to avoid washed out or muddy blacks.
    Fine-tune Tonal Curve / LevelsGives control over midtones, blacks, whites.
    Texture, Grain, Film-Style OverlaysAdds character: film grain, dust, grain, borders, old photo effects.
    Masking / Selective ColourAbility to keep part of image in colour while rest is monochrome (“color splash”) or edit parts separately.
    Background Removal / Background ChangeFor placing subjects on black backgrounds or replacing background with dark tones.
    Batch ProcessingGood for creators needing consistency across many images.
    High Resolution ExportingTo preserve quality; especially if you’re printing or using on large displays.
    User Interface & Ease of UseSliders, live preview, non-destructive editing are helpful.
    Presets / Custom FiltersSave time, create your own look and apply across images.
    Video Support (if needed)If editing video, filters / effects that work with video + ability to export properly.

    Popular Apps & Tools Focusing on Black / Monochrome / Dark Aesthetic

    Here are some popular apps and tools for black, dark, or monochrome editing, along with their key strengths:

    App / ToolStrengths & FeaturesPlatforms / Cost Etc.
    BLVCK – Black & White EffectMore than 50 B&W filters; textures like grain, dust, light leaks; photo borders; fairly simple interface for black and white transformations. (Apple)
    VSCOClassic B&W film-style presets, ability to adjust contrast etc., add grain, film-frames, effects. Good for mood & aesthetic. (VSCO®)
    DarkroomPowerful non-destructive tools, adjust curves, selective colour, able to edit RAW, batch processing; strong for users who want more control. (Darkroom)
    FotorOnline tool and app; background change/removal, black background options; easier for casual users. (Fotor)
    PicsartHas good background changer tools, black background/photo editing, batch processing; lots of creative options. (Picsart)

    Challenges & Things to Watch Out For

    • Loss of shadow detail: Making blacks too deep can hide texture, and pure black often loses fine details. Balancing shadows and highlights is essential.
    • Washed-out highlights: Over-brightening whites can create harsh contrast and reduce smooth tonal gradation.
    • Overuse of grain or texture: Excessive grain can make images noisy or distracting.
    • Flat images: Without color, images may lack visual “pop” unless contrast, lighting, and composition are carefully managed.
    • Exporting issues: Low-resolution exports or heavy compression can degrade black tones and overall quality.
    • Device and display variation: Blacks may appear grey or lose contrast on different screens.
    • Over-processing: Using too many overlays or filters can make the image look overdone rather than artistic.

    Tips & Techniques for Best Results

    Start with strong lighting

    Directional light, side light, backlight, or rim light enhances shadows and highlights, providing a solid foundation for dark edits.

    Shoot in RAW when possible

    RAW files offer greater flexibility for recovering shadows and highlights, giving you more control over black tones.

    Use curves and levels adjustments

    Adjust tonal curves to manage pure blacks, mid-tones, and highlights. Keep blacks deep but not overly crushed unless intentionally creating a moody aesthetic.

    Work with selective detail

    For effects like color splash or subject emphasis, selectively mask backgrounds or colors to draw attention where it matters most.

    Add texture or subtle grain

    Light grain can add character and mood, but avoid heavy grain that overwhelms the image.

    Apply contrast thoughtfully

    Boost contrast to make the subject pop, but preserve subtle tonal nuances for a balanced, professional look.

    Experiment with background options

    Dark gradients, textured backgrounds, or slightly off-black tones often provide more visual richness than flat black.

    Maintain consistency across series

    For Instagram feeds, portfolios, or branding, create a preset or workflow to unify your dark-themed images.

    Check on multiple devices

    Blacks and contrast can appear differently on phones, tablets, and laptops—review across devices to ensure consistency.

    Focus on composition

    Without color, composition becomes crucial. Pay attention to lines, shapes, interplay of light and shadow, and negative space.

    Use Cases & Examples

    Portrait Photography

    Create black & white portraits with high-contrast lighting to highlight facial features, texture, and mood.

    Architecture & Landscape

    Emphasize dramatic clouds, shadows, and building textures, or enhance the contrast between sky and structures for striking visuals.

    Product & Branding

    Use dark backgrounds to make colorful or metallic products stand out, or maintain a consistent minimalist aesthetic for online stores and brand visuals.

    Social Media & Mood Boards

    Curate Instagram feeds, Pinterest boards, or Tumblr posts where a cohesive dark or black aesthetic creates a trendy, eye-catching theme.

    Film & Video

    Apply noir styles, cinematic looks, or moody edits in music videos, teasers, or short films to create a dramatic atmosphere.

    What to Look for When Choosing the Right App

    • Editing device: Will you work on a phone, tablet, or PC?
    • Video editing capabilities: Do you need the app to handle video as well as photos?
    • Level of control: Do you prefer manual adjustments or quick one-tap filters?
    • Background and masking tools: Are selective editing and masking options included?
    • Cost: Many apps offer free versions, but advanced features like textures, RAW support, video export, or high-resolution output may require payment.
    • Learning curve: Some apps are user-friendly, while others demand advanced skills and practice.

    Future Directions & Trends

    • AI-powered editing: Features like auto-masking, intelligent lighting enhancement, and automatic black & white conversion preserve mood and emotion effortlessly.
    • Dynamic filters: Filters that adapt to image content, adjusting differently for portraits, landscapes, or other scenes.
    • Advanced video tools: High-quality monochrome video editing is becoming more accessible for creators.
    • Cross-platform syncing: Easily sync presets and profiles across devices for a consistent workflow.
    • Real-time preview filters: See exactly how edits will look before capturing photos or videos, making adjustments faster and more intuitive.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    What is a black photo editing app?

    A black photo editing app allows you to convert images or videos to black & white or dark tones, enhance shadows and highlights, and create moody, dramatic visuals.

    Which apps are best for black and white editing?

    Popular apps include Adobe Lightroom, Snapseed, Nik Silver Efex, Lenka, and Darkroom, each offering unique features like presets, AI filters, and advanced tonal controls.

    Can these apps be used for videos as well?

    Yes, some apps like Adobe Lightroom and Darkroom support video editing, enabling black & white or dark-tone adjustments for cinematic clips.

    Are black photo editing apps free?

    Many apps offer free versions, but advanced features such as RAW support, high-resolution exports, or premium filters often require a paid subscription or in-app purchase.

    How do I make my dark edits look professional?

    Focus on lighting, contrast, shadows, texture, and composition. Using RAW files, selective masking, and subtle grain also improves results.

    Can I apply selective color or “color splash” effects?

    Yes, many apps let you highlight specific areas in color while keeping the rest of the image monochrome for dramatic effect.

    Which devices support black photo editing apps?

    Most apps are cross-platform, supporting iOS, Android, tablets, and desktop computers. Some also sync presets across devices.
